Description

Unearth the mysteries, myths, strange happenings, and haunted places in Wisconsin's history. This intriguing, lively, and easy-to-read collection of eerie stories will leave readers astonished at the secrets it reveals.

About the Author

Michael Bie, a Green Bay native, was formally educated at UW-Stevens Point and informally educated at the Upper Wisconsin River Yacht Club, Stevens Point; Del's Bar, La Crosse; and The Joynt, Eau Claire. As a freelance writer, he has multiple magazine and newspaper credits to his name. He can usually be found pursuing an interest in all things Wisconsin. Bie even spent several summers crisscrossing the state by bicycle until he realized that motor vehicles provided the same service in a fraction of the time. Occasionally he considers taking his bike out of storage.
